Associate Specialist, University of California, Irvine
One of my interests as a researcher is to understand how the environment interacts with our genome to sculpt phenotypic variation and disease.
I am currently studying the effect of obesogen exposure during pregnancy, not only in the offspring but also in subsequent generations.
